Spice Stellar Pinnacle Mi-530 announced for India: 5.3-inch qHD screen, 5MP front-facing camera, 1.2GHz dual-core CPU

February 1, 2013 by Dusan Belic - Leave a Comment

Spice Stellar Pinnacle Mi-530 announced for India
Share on Twitter Share on Facebook ( 0 shares )

Spice Mobile launched a somewhat interesting smartphone in India – Spice Stellar Pinnacle Mi-530. The device is unique in that sense that it has a 5-megapixel front camera with auto-focus, making it a potential hit among the self-portrait addicts.

In addition, this phone also comes with a large 5.3-inch qHD (540×960 pixels) display, 1.2GHz dual-core processor, 1GB of RAM, 16GB of internal storage, 8-megapixel rear camera, Bluetooth 4.0, solid 2,550mAh battery, while Android 4.0 Ice Cream Sandwich is running the show (upgradable to Jelly Bean). Plus, let’s not forget two SIM card slots, one of which supports 3G connectivity, as well as pre-installed software tricks that include Popup Play, Flip to Mute, Direct Call and Intelligent Answer.

The best part is the price – the Spice Stellar Pinnacle Mi-530 could be yours for just 13,999 Rupees, which translates into some $260… If you live in India and like what you’ve read, you can buy the phone at Saholic.com.
